Bifolium from a Qur'an, late 9th–10th century, Attributed to Central Islamic Lands or North Africa, Ink, opaque watercolor, and gold on parchment, 9 1/8 x 25 5/16 in. (23.2 x 64.3 cm), Codices, This double folio was once bound in a multivolume Qur'an manuscript. The calligrapher wrote in bold kufic script with black ink using a broad nibbed reed pen. Red and green dots indicate the vowels. Verse markers include a star shaped medallion highlighted with green and red dots and framed by two concentric multilobed medallions
